quote: Originally posted by SL302: So the problem with my 90 5.0 is I turn the key to start the car, cranks and fires up but when I let go it turns off. How do I replace it? or is it easier just buying a new one?
how do you know it's the igntion lock cylinder? to change it, remove the plastics around the colum, put the key in the ignition and turn the key into the on position. undernieth there is a small pin hole , stick a small nail,screwdriver, pin ect. an then wigle it out. disconnect the electrical wire and then put it back in the way u took it out. hope this helps

It's fixed I guess the ignition switch wires on the steering column were loose from wear, used some zip ties and it works now.
